Dictionary of English Literature


A  comprehensive reference guide to major authors, works, and literary movements in English literature. It provides clear, concise entries that help readers understand key literary terms, historical contexts, and the development of English writing from its beginnings to the modern age.

A Frequency Dictionary of British English


 

A Frequency Dictionary of British English  is a resource for learners and educators that focuses on the most commonly used words in contemporary British English. It is built from the British National Corpus 2014, which comprises 100 million words spanning spoken and written genres (including informal speech, fiction, academic texts, newspapers, e-language)

The book presents vocabulary organized by frequency (how often words appear), by word-class (verbs, nouns, adjectives, etc.), and in alphabetical form; it also includes visualisations to show how word usage varies across different registers or contexts. 

Alongside the frequency lists, there are  exercises for learners to practice activating and familiarising themselves with vocabulary in useful, meaningful ways. The dictionary also introduces a “New General Service List (New GSL)” — a modern selection of high-utility words that provides strong coverage for learners. 

Designed for a broad audience (students, teachers, material developers, researchers, and journalists), it aims to give tools to understand which words matter most in British English now, and to help learners build vocabulary efficiently and with awareness of use.
